能够输出5V信号电平的stm32
时间: 2023-12-24 21:04:20 浏览: 75
大多数STM32微控制器的IO引脚只能输出3.3V的信号电平,不能输出5V的信号电平。如果需要输出5V的信号电平,可以通过使用晶体管、场效应管等元器件搭建电平转换电路,将STM32的3.3V信号电平转换为5V信号电平。另外,也可以使用一些支持5V信号电平的STM32开发板,这些开发板通常会在IO口输出处加上电平转换电路,可以直接输出5V信号电平。但需要注意的是,使用电平转换电路时要注意防止电压过高或过低,避免对STM32芯片造成损坏。
相关问题
如何在stm32输出5V的信号电平
在STM32输出5V的信号电平需要使用外部电路进行电平转换,因为STM32的IO口输出电平一般为3.3V或者3.0V,无法直接输出5V电平。常用的电平转换电路有两种:
1. 电路中加入一个晶体管,晶体管的基极接STM32的IO口,集电极接5V电源,发射极接待转换的设备。当STM32的IO口输出高电平时,晶体管导通,5V电源输出到待转换设备上,达到输出5V信号电平的目的。
2. 电路中加入一个双向电平转换芯片,如74HC4050等,将STM32的3.3V电平转换成5V电平。具体操作方式需要查看芯片的数据手册。
需要注意的是,使用外部电路进行电平转换时,要确保电路可靠、稳定,避免电路噪声、电源波动等因素对信号的影响。
stm32f103c8t6引脚输出5v
STM32F103C8T6是一款32位的ARM Cortex-M3微控制器,它的引脚输出电压是3.3V,而不是5V。这是因为STM32F103C8T6是一款3.3V工作电压的芯片,它的IO引脚的输出电平也是3.3V。如果你需要将其输出电平升高到5V,可以使用逻辑电平转换器或者电平转换电路来实现。
逻辑电平转换器是一种常用的解决方案,它可以将3.3V的逻辑电平转换为5V的逻辑电平。你可以选择一款适合你需求的逻辑电平转换器芯片,例如TXS0108E或者74HC4050等。这些芯片可以将STM32F103C8T6的3.3V逻辑电平转换为5V逻辑电平,从而实现引脚输出5V。
另外,如果你需要在STM32F103C8T6上输出5V的模拟信号,你可以使用外部电路来实现。例如,使用运放来放大STM32F103C8T6的输出信号,从而得到5V的模拟信号。